Mosely: What does the surname Mosely mean?

The surname Mosely is of English origin and is derived from the Old English pre 7th Century term "moos", meaning peat bog, and "leah", translating to wood or clearing. Therefore, it can be taken to mean ‘clearing in the marsh’. The name is locational in nature, referring to individuals who were residing in or near places like Moseley in West Yorkshire or Moseley in Birmingham. Over time, the spelling has evolved into numerous variants, including Moseley, Mosely, Mosley, Mosly, among others. As with many surnames that have their origin in location naming, it may have been used to signify someone who had moved from Moseley to a different area, thereby helping in identifying their origin. The surname was first recorded in the latter part of the 12th century.
